MERCEDES C350 BALANCE SHAFT FAILURE PROBLEMS IN EDMONTON

The 2007 to 2011 Mercedes-Benz C350 equipped with the M272 3.5L V6 engine shares the same balance shaft sprocket defect that has affected hundreds of thousands of Mercedes vehicles globally. COMMON MERCEDES C350 BALANCE SHAFT FAILURE ISSUES

Common concerns for the Mercedes C350 Balance Shaft Failure include:

  • Engine serial at risk: below 272.xxx 30468993
  • Common fault codes: P0016, P0017, Mercedes codes 1208/1210
  • Symptoms: valve train clatter, rough idle, check engine light
  • Repair requires engine removal — 30+ hour job — $5,000 to
  • 2007-2011 Mercedes C350 Sport and Luxury (W204)
  • 2008-2011 C350 4Matic (all-wheel drive)

SYMPTOMS, MILEAGE AND REPAIR RANGES

Additional symptoms, mileage patterns and repair information include:

  • Engine serial number verification and risk assessment
  • Full engine removal and balance shaft access
  • Sprocket and idler gear replacement with updated Mercedes repair kit
  • Timing chain inspection — replacement if wear detected
  • Oil system flush — metal particles from sprocket wear

Does the Mercedes C350 have balance shaft problems?

Yes. The 2007-2011 C350 with the M272 engine is subject to the same balance shaft sprocket defect as all M272-equipped Mercedes vehicles from this era. Check the engine serial number to determine risk.

How much does Mercedes C350 balance shaft repair cost?

At Auto Imports, M272 balance shaft repair on the C350 typically ranges from $5,000 to $10,000 — a major job requiring full engine removal.
